How much does it cost to rent a home in Heath?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Heath 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,056 | $1,685 | $2,650 |
Heath 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,268 | $1,825 | $5,200 |
Heath 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,646 | $2,150 | $4,000 |
Heath 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,642 | $2,599 | $5,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Heath
What type of rentals are currently available in Heath?
There are currently 56 Apartments for Rent in Heath, TX with pricing that ranges from $784 to $7,765. There are also 82 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Heath ranging from $873 to $5,300.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Heath?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Heath ranges from $873 to $5,300 with an average monthly rent of $2,416.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Heath?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Heath range from $1,225 to $6,087,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,825 to $5,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,150 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,362.
